Transaction 56247d37f3a4cd3445233ac601bac895c6eab167bdb5d3dd693ab9094eaf644a
1 Input
2 Outputs
- 56247d37f3a4cd3445233ac601bac895c6eab167bdb5d3dd693ab9094eaf644a:0
- 56247d37f3a4cd3445233ac601bac895c6eab167bdb5d3dd693ab9094eaf644a:1
value 578354
address 1ttau4JRn8Cc4XTyxedcCXfGh5k5nZUN5
value 107558
address 16rFiZynNbX4vUHQLKsjb6t4pMhBbjKrVX